Output 51b161f2615ecbb0290114bf4b83d27d6277e5d7e32d7d3aa9002faccfa27f45:1

value
1170321
script pubkey
OP_0 OP_PUSHBYTES_20 362376ccf35fe276d7337e539eebc6fc49baf055
address
ltc1qxc3hdn8ntl38d4en0efea67xl3ym4uz4lezxnq
transaction
51b161f2615ecbb0290114bf4b83d27d6277e5d7e32d7d3aa9002faccfa27f45
spent
true